The Power of Trust in Web3
The foundation of blockchain technology lies in its ability to create trust without intermediaries. In traditional media, trust is often an intangible asset, difficult to quantify. However, blockchain media can provide a transparent and immutable record of content creation and distribution, ensuring that users can trust the source of information.
Case Study: Steemit
Consider Steemit, a blockchain-based social media platform that rewards users for creating and curating content. By using its native cryptocurrency, Steem, users can earn real value for their contributions. This not only incentivizes high-quality content but also establishes a direct relationship between creators and their audience, fostering a sense of community and trust.

The Rise of NFTs in Media
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) have revolutionized the way digital assets are owned and traded. In blockchain media, NFTs can be used to tokenize exclusive content or even entire publications. This not only provides creators with new revenue streams but also gives consumers ownership over digital assets they love.
User Engagement Through Tokenomics
Tokenomics plays a crucial role in Web3 startups by incentivizing user engagement. Blockchain media platforms can issue tokens that represent voting rights or access to premium content. This creates a direct financial stake for users in the platform's success, fostering loyalty and active participation.
